Chutiabhadri - Binpur - II, Jhargram

Chutiabhadri is a village situated in the Binpur - II subdivision of Jhargram district, West Bengal. It is located approximately 38.2 km from Lalgarh. Sandapara serves as the Gram Panchayat for Chutiabhadri village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Chutiabhadri is 335581. The village covers a total geographical area of 134.9 hectares and falls under the 721501 pincode. Chakulia is the nearest town, located about 16 km away.

Chutiabhadri village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Chutiabhadri

As per Census 2011, Chutiabhadri village has a total population of 458 people, consisting of 225 males and 233 females. The village has 102 households and a sex ratio of 1,035 females per 1,000 males. There are 72 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 256 literate and 202 illiterate residents. Additionally, 215 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Chutiabhadri

Chutiabhadri is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ared van services. The nearest railway station is located within >10 km of Chutiabhadri.

In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Chakulia to Chutiabhadri is about 16 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
